Description:
Poet, theatrical figure, translator.

Biography

Was born in 1838 in Constantinopol, Turkey.

Education

Work Activity

  • Since 1858 had worked at the Constantinopol telegraph.

Other

  • The main theme of his works is the protest against social injustice.
  • In his works of love and nature, contrasts the beauties of the Nature with the human misery.
  • In 1870-1880s was one of the leaders in the struggle for realism.
  • His translations of Schiller, Lamten, Lafonte, Bernanke and other French writers were published in separate books.
